Past: The Devil

In the past, The Devil card suggests that you may have been trapped in a situation that brought about feelings of bondage, addiction, or unhealthy behaviors. It could indicate a period of temptation or being controlled by material desires.

Present: Two of Cups

The Two of Cups in the present position signifies a harmonious and balanced relationship, whether romantic or platonic. This card indicates a deep connection, mutual respect, and emotional fulfillment. It suggests that you are currently experiencing a period of love, partnership, and cooperation.

Future: Four of Swords

Looking into the future, the Four of Swords suggests a time for rest, contemplation, and recuperation. It indicates a period of mental peace and tranquility, where you may need to take a step back to heal and regain your strength. This card advises you to find inner peace and take a break before moving forward.

Conclusion

Overall, the tarot reading indicates a significant shift from the challenges and entrapment of the past (The Devil) toward a more harmonious and fulfilling present (Two of Cups). In the future, you are guided to prioritize self-care and introspection (Four of Swords) to ensure you are ready for what lies ahead. It's important to acknowledge the progress made and embrace the need for rest and healing as you move forward on your journey.
